First off, Sandro was student of sorcerer and later lich Ethric the Mad. You have this written in Sandro biography in H3.
Ethric died during MM6 which takes place in year 1165 After Silence. MM7 starts in year 1169 AS, so there is no wonder that some loot from Ethric's Tomb could ended on Antagarich.
Now for the SoD itself. Sandro always was a lich - back to H1 (25 years before H2) and H2 (10 years before H3 and MM6). He used illusion for deception and to cheat wizards from Bracada.
Next, Ethric from SoD was a mage from Bracada (it is stated in Gem campaign), who was against necromancy - something opposite to Ethric the Mad philosophy. In Rise of the Necromancer the same Ethric from Bracada was described as a warlock - someone opposite to mages from Bracada.
Now, from where this mess started? After AB main person who know much about HoMM lore departed from NWC, so there was no one, who ever know, who is who or what has happened in previous games. So SoD creators just took some familiar names and created new stories for them. They probably wanted to introduce Ethric from MM6 but ended messing so much in his story, that this character can't be the same lich as in MM6.
This can happen to Ashan too - if from any reason Marzhin would leave, Erwan probably never will know, what has happened in previous games, even if he has his "bible" to help.

1. Actually H2 story, even if it is simple tale about war between good and bad brother, is a good campaign - you can choose your lord, betray or not him, do optional missions, choose who to help and which side should win.
HV story is plain and simple form point A to point B with lots of "casts random spell" dialogues.
It is not about how complicated the story is - it is about how it was shown. And HV failed this.
2. Heroes Chronicles used stuff from AB to tell stories about Antagarich. AB wasn't created with mind for HC. Actually AB was created as a bridge between MM and HoMM games but this was cut after Forge cancellation.
3DO wanted to milk H3, that is why Heroes Chronicles were created.
3. There aren't Ancients in HC. In HC you have Ancestors, barbarian gods.
4. Price of Loyalty campaigns were created not by NWC but by Cyberlore and their story not really fit to HoMM lore. SoD was created as explanation what has happened between H2 and H3 and which events started RoE campaign.

1. NWC universe was original. True, it has a lot influence from D&D but at least all concept were introduced in some different ways. There aren't any beholders in HoMM games - you have Evil Eyes which were created by crazy warlock, who also created minotaurs.
We have also Dark Elves but they are not backstabbing cave dwellers, ruled by women, as some other Dark Elves in D&D or in Ashan. You had Dark Elves, who are merchants and use economic and alliances to dominate all of their continent. And they are not evil.
2. Not really - there are some points which are meesed but overall story is quite simple. For first 5 MM games it is story about Corak and Sheltem. For HoMM games it is about Ironfist dynasty (Catheriene is Ironfist as she married Roland). For MM6-9 games it is story about Ancients-Kreegan war. The hard point is that sometimes stories from MM6-9 and HoMM2-4 games are connected and that is all.
You have the same thing in Ashan - Clash of Heroes and Dark Messiah are connected to HV, Duel of Champions, HoMM Online and Raiders are connected to HVI. And HVI is connected to HV (of course) but also Clash of Heroes.
3. It wasn't about starting new story - that is OK, as we have new planets/continents in previous HoMM/MM games. It was saying that old universe and previous games didn't exist (not by words but that was idea of introducing Ashan mythology). Now, with introduction of Void and legacy heroes, Ubisoft seems to understand, that this was a mistake and created backdoor... if they will needed sometime in future.
